## Vendor Note: Squatcheck Scanner

All plugins submitted to the Larkspur marketplace are scanned by Squatcheck for typo-squatting package names before publication. Flagged submissions are held, not rejected; authors get a review window of five business days. Do not resubmit under a variant name — that triggers an automatic block. To dispute a flag or request an expedited review, contact the registry team at the address below.

alerts address for bawif-hahig: norwyn_gorys_lamath@olvarqlabs.test

MEMO — Uniform delivery for the new Askerton depot

To the shift lead: twelve cartons of Greyline-branded uniforms arrive Thursday for the Askerton opening. Do not break down the cartons; they ship onward as received. Stage them at bay 5, away from general stock — sizes are pre-sorted per carton and must stay matched. Onward courier is booked for Friday 07:30. Count cartons against the manifest before release; shortages go to me same day. Note: the hand-over instruction below is confidential — relay it to the courier verbally.

handover note for yagef-bagep: the drudor pelius courier leaves the kasdor zorvan norir ledger at gate 8016 under passcode 755406

**Vendor note: Inkmill markdown pipeline**

Rendering for Parchway docs is outsourced to Inkmill under an annual contract, renewing each March. They handle sanitization and PDF export; we own the upload queue. SLA: 4-hour response on rendering failures. Escalate only after two failed retries. Their support desk is reachable at the address below.

billing contact of hahaf-baguf = zorael.tammir.jorius@sivrelhq.internal

## Changelog — Quillboard 3.2

### Changed defaults

Sorting in the Quillboard report builder is now stable by default. Previously, rows with equal sort keys could shuffle between runs, which confused everyone comparing exports. Tie-breaking now falls back to row insertion order. You can revert to the old behavior if you really must via these configuration values.

deployment values, yahag-tawef:
ZORWYN_HOST=zorwyn.tolvaqlabs.internal
ZORWYN_PORT=9300